I am trying to select from sql database on page load, and i want to write out that selection to a label.

here is what i have so far, but it seems to not be working.

VB
Session("UserInfo") = DotNetNuke.Entities.Users.UserController.GetCurrentUserInfo().Username
WelcomeLabel.Text = Session.Item("UserInfo").ToString()

Dim dt As New DataTable()
Dim connection As New SqlConnection("mystring")
connection.Open()
Dim sqlCmd As New SqlCommand("SELECT EMPID FROM EMPEmployees WHERE EMPUserName = '" & WelcomeLabel.Text & "'", connection)
Dim sqlDa As New SqlDataAdapter(sqlCmd)

sqlDa.Fill(dt)
If dt.Rows.Count > 0 Then
    EMPIDLabel.Text = dt.Rows(0)("EMPID").ToString()
End If

Can anyone fill me in on how to make this work?
